About Jules A. A. C. Heuberger

Jules A. A. C. Heuberger is a scholar working on Endocrine and Autonomic Systems, Pharmacology and Toxicology, having authored 40 papers that have together received 837 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cannabis and Cannabinoid Research (7 papers), Hormonal and reproductive studies (5 papers) and Erythropoietin and Anemia Treatment (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Toxicology (61 citations), Pharmacology (205 citations) and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(58 citations). Jules A. A. C. Heuberger has collaborated with scholars based in Netherlands,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Adam F. Cohen, Geert Jan Groeneveld, Hartmut Derendorf, Joop van Gerven, Stephan Schmidt, Tim L. Beumer, Jacobus Burggraaf, Frederik E. Stuurman, Pierre‐Éric Juif and Laura H. Heitman.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, Blood and PLoS ONE.
